河北幼儿托管班小程序开发工具是一款用于帮助幼儿托管班管理的小程序开发工具。它能够帮助幼儿托管班更好地管理幼儿,包括幼儿信息管理、家长信息管理、托管日程安排、收费管理等等。以下是该小程序开发工具的原理或详细介绍。
1.前端界面设计:
河北幼儿托管班小程序开发工具前端采用微信小程序开发平台进行开发,使用Vue作为开发框架,UI界面采用微信小程序的自定义组件,将小程序界面开发分为幼儿信息管理、家长信息管理、宿舍信息管理、托管日程安排、收费管理等模块,并对各个模块进行完整的设计和实现,保证用户操作流畅并且交互性好。
2.后端架构设计:
该小程序开发工具后端采用Spring MVC框架进行开发。在使用该开发框架时,需要使用MyBatis框架来进行数据持久化,因为MyBatis具有灵活的SQL映射和缓存机制,能够充分利用数据库并且提高查询速度。数据库采用MySQL进行搭建,使用MySQL的主从数据库架构,提高数据访问速度和稳定性。后端实现了一些公用的API,包括登录、注册、身份验证等等。同时,也实现了一些特定的API,例如幼儿信息管理、家长信息管理、宿舍信息管理、托管日程安排、收费管理等等。
3.主要功能模块:
①幼儿信息管理:根据幼儿的姓名、性别、出生日期、籍贯、身高、体重、照片等信息对幼儿信息进行管理。包括幼儿信息录入、幼儿信息修改、幼儿信息查询等功能。
②家长信息管理:根据家长的姓名、性别、身份证号、联系方式等信息对家长信息进行管理。包括家长信息录入、家长信息修改、家长信息查询等功能。
③宿舍信息管理:对于住宿在幼儿托管班的幼儿,需要对其宿舍信息进行管理,包括宿舍号、床号、入住日期、退住日期等信息。包括宿舍信息录入、宿舍信息修改、宿舍信息查询等功能。
④托管日程安排:管理幼儿的托管时间和各项安排。包括托管班次添加、托管班次修改、托管班次查询等功能。
⑤收费管理:管理幼儿托管班的收费信息,包括缴费时间、缴费金额、缴费方式等。包括收费记录录入、收费记录修改、收费记录查询等功能。
4.安全性设计:
该小程序开发工具设置了身份验证功能,包括登录和注册功能。并且将用户密码进行加密,保证用户密码安全。同时,在设置API时,也会进行权限控制,确保只有具有相关权限的人员可以对关键数据进行操作。
总之,河北幼儿托管班小程序开发工具是一款能够提高幼儿托管班管理效率的小程序。通过前端界面设计和后端架构设计的优化,保证了该工具的高效性和安全性。同时,其涵盖的多个模块可以满足幼儿托管班对幼儿管理的各种需求。